x86/mm: support __HAVE_ARCH_PTE_SWP_EXCLUSIVE also on 32bit
Let's support __HAVE_ARCH_PTE_SWP_EXCLUSIVE just like we already do on x86-64. After deciphering the PTE layout it becomes clear that there are still unused bits for 2-level and 3-level page tables that we should be able to use. Reusing a bit avoids stealing one bit from the swap offset. While at it, mask the type in __swp_entry(); use some helper definitions to make the macros easier to grasp.
